I went to a consult last week with Dr. Linda Haung. Between seeing some results form this site and other articles i have found i decided to go with her. Im booked for June 19th. I am so scared of what im going to look like after and getting put under. Shes going to be going threw the same scars the arerola like i did when i got my ba. Im not 100% happy with my scars and would like her to fix them and hope she can remove a little skin so i wont be too saggy after the expant. I also went with her becaues shes going to be taking out all the scar tissue as well. I am so anxious and scared all these emotions im not sure how to deal with them right now. I wish i never got implants in the first place. Im 31 and hope my skin will go back i had hardly a B before my ba, i dont care how small i am i just want them to look somewhat normal.

First Consultation down.......
So i just went to my first consultation and it didn't help much. He was very nice man and explained everything but also kept telling me i should keep my implants because they weren't harmful to me and my last doctor did an amazing job. He didn't really seem on my side. I also felt like he talked more about keeping them or sizing down than anything else. I was quoted a little over $5,000. I guess it didn't make me feel any better with what I'm leaning towards. I'm suppose I'm on the hunt for another doctor.
